Asbestos Lawsuit Attorneys

A skilled mesothelioma lawyer can create a strong asbestos case. They know where to look for evidence of exposure in the past like the person's work history as well as job sites.

They also know how to use veterans benefits as well as asbestos trust funds, among other methods of compensation. These help victims to receive an appropriate settlement.

Asbestos lawsuits typically include a claim for compensation against a business that produced or distributed asbestos-related products as well as any companies that exposed workers to the harmful substances. The lawsuits are filed to claim damages for past and future medical expenses, lost wages and suffering and pain. The amount of damages is usually greater than those offered by workers' compensation.

Many asbestos manufacturers were forced to close due to the plethora of lawsuits filed against them. In the wake of the asbestos trust fund, billions have been set aside to pay families and victims.

A mesothelioma lawyer can assist you file a lawsuit against the maker of asbestos-related products or companies that exposed you to asbestos. They can also give you guidance on the best method to file a suit as well as the length of time you're allowed to file.

Jessica Dean is a top mesothelioma attorney in the United States. She is a partner at the Dean Omar Branham-Shirley law office and has won several mesothelioma lawsuits that have been featured in the media. One of her latest victories was a $54 million verdict in Chapman v. Avon Products. The jury determined that Ms. Chapman developed mesothelioma after decades of using Avon's asbestos-containing Talcum powder.
